Bali is a Saxdor 400 GTO — a brand-new day cruiser from 2024 and one of the youngest yachts in my portfolio. Saxdor is a Scandinavian yard that has reached cult status in a remarkably short time with its clean, sporty lines and clever walkaround deck.
At 12.40 metres and with twin Mercury V10 outboards of 400 hp each, Bali is seriously quick — up to 40 knots top speed and 35 knots cruising — and at the same time surprisingly spacious. The T-top shades the helm station and the cockpit lounge, while the expansive teak aft deck and the sun pads on the bow invite you to sunbathe and swim. The wide stern platform becomes a beach club right at the water, complete with YachtBeach bathing island and water toys.
Up to eleven guests can be on board during the day; below deck there is a cabin with bathroom for changing or a break in the shade. Bali is designed as a day charter and is operated by a skipper.
Her home port is Marina Cuarentena in Palma. For a fast, stylish day in the bays around Palma and along the southwest coast, she is one of my favourite new recommendations.
